Regular Evaluation and Maintenance
Among one of the most vital aspects of plumbing maintenance is conducting regular evaluations. Check for leaks, drips, and signs of corrosion in pipes, fixtures, and appliances. Attending to small concerns early can aid avoid even more substantial troubles down the line.

Sump Pump Upkeep


If your home has a sump pump, make certain it is working correctly, especially throughout heavy rainfall. Check the pump on a regular basis and maintain the pit free of debris to prevent blockages.

Checking Water Stress


High water stress can damage pipelines and fixtures, while reduced pressure can suggest underlying plumbing problems. Use a pressure scale to monitor water pressure and readjust it as needed.

Preserving Outdoor Plumbing


Throughout the warmer months, inspect outside taps, hoses, and lawn sprinkler for leakages or damages. Shut off exterior water sources prior to the first adhere prevent burst pipelines.

Educating Family Members


Obtain everyone in your family associated with pipes maintenance. Instruct member of the family just how to spot leaks, turned off the water, and make use of plumbing fixtures responsibly.

Professional Plumbing Assessments


In addition to do it yourself maintenance tasks, schedule routine evaluations with a qualified plumbing professional. A professional can determine potential concerns early and advise preventive measures to keep your pipes system in top problem.

Water Heater Upkeep


Water heaters should be purged consistently to remove debris build-up and preserve efficiency. Inspect the temperature level and pressure safety valve for leaks and make certain correct ventilation around the device.

Avoiding Pipes Emergencies


While some pipes emergencies are inescapable, many can be stopped with proper upkeep. Know where your major water shut-off valve lies and just how to utilize it in case of an emergency situation. Think about mounting water leak detection gadgets for included defense.

Addressing Minor Issues Quickly


Don't overlook tiny pipes problems like dripping faucets or running commodes. Also minor leaks can throw away substantial amounts of water in time and cause costly water damages. Dealing with these concerns quickly can conserve you money in the future.

Preserving Drainpipes and Sewers


Clogged drains and sewage system lines can lead to back-ups and costly repair services. To avoid this, stay clear of flushing non-biodegradable things down the toilet and usage drainpipe screens to catch hair and debris. Regularly flush drains with hot water and cooking soft drink to maintain them clear.

Shielding Pipes from Cold


In colder climates, frozen pipes can be a significant concern during the winter months. To prevent pipes from cold and bursting, shield revealed pipelines, separate exterior tubes, and maintain taps leaking throughout freezing temperature levels.

Water Top Quality Screening


On a regular basis examine your water top quality to guarantee it satisfies safety standards. Take into consideration setting up a water filtering system if your water contains contaminations or has an unpleasant preference or odor.

Garbage Disposal Upkeep


To keep your waste disposal unit running smoothly, prevent putting coarse or starchy foods, oil, or non-food products away. Periodically grind ice and citrus peels to tidy and ventilate the disposal.

Recognizing and Addressing Leaks in Home Plumbing


Leaks in your home plumbing system can be a silent culprit, leading to gallons of wasted water, higher bills, and potential damage to your home’s infrastructure. Timely detection and repair of plumbing leaks are essential to maintain the integrity of your plumbing pipes and avoid unnecessary water usage.



This section will guide you through simple DIY methods for leak detection, using tools like food coloring, and understanding when it’s time to shut off the water supply and call a plumber for more complex issues.



These tips will help you manage the water flow and safeguard your home’s plumbing systems, including sewers and sprinkler systems, from the adverse effects of leaks.


  • Monitor Water Usage: Keep an eye on your water meter to track any unexpected increase in water usage, which can indicate hidden leaks.


  • Check for Corrosion: Regularly inspect pipes in your home for signs of corrosion, as corroded pipes are more prone to leaking.


  • Toilet Paper Test: Place a few pieces of toilet paper at the back of the bowl after flushing for a quick check of toilet leaks. If the paper sticks, it may indicate a slow leak.


  • Gallons Count: Be aware of the gallons of water your household typically uses. A significant deviation might suggest leaks.


  • Main Water Shut-Off Valve: Familiarize yourself with the location of the main water shut-off valve in your home. Quickly shutting off the water can prevent extensive damage in case of a significant leak.


  • Regular Pipe Inspections: Regularly inspect exposed pipes for any signs of damage or leaks, which can prevent costly plumbing repairs.


  • Professional Inspections for Home Improvement: If you plan any home improvement projects, include a professional plumbing inspection to identify and address hidden issues.

  • Maintaining Your Water Heater


  • Flush Your Water Heater: Regular flushing of your water heater can remove sediment build-up, enhancing efficiency and prolonging its life.


  • Signs of Trouble: Watch out for rusty water or a lack of hot water, which might indicate it’s time for a check-up or replacement.


  • Professional Inspection: Annual professional inspections can prevent unforeseen breakdowns and maintain optimal performance.


  • Keeping Drains Clear


  • Preventing Clogs: Use filters in sinks and showers to prevent hair and debris from clogging drains.


  • Natural Cleaning Solutions: A baking soda and vinegar mixture can effectively maintain clear drains without damaging pipes.


  • Professional Drain Cleaning: Professional drain cleaning services can provide a thorough solution for stubborn clogs.
